Crushed Stone and Gravel Products

Crushed stone remains the foundation of countless construction and improvement projects across Hot Springs. Our 3/4 inch crushed stone delivers exceptional versatility for driveways, parking areas, and foundation work throughout the area. This angular aggregate compacts firmly while maintaining excellent drainage properties essential for managing the 56 inches of annual rainfall Hot Springs receives.

For projects requiring superior compaction, #57 stone provides an ideal balance between size and stability. This popular aggregate works wonderfully for French drains around homes in the Park Avenue Historic District and helps manage water flow on the natural slopes common throughout Hot Springs.

Base and Foundation Aggregates

Proper base preparation determines the long-term success of any paving or construction project in Hot Springs. Our crusher run combines crushed stone with fine particles that compact into an incredibly stable base layer. This aggregate blend excels on the sloped lots common in areas like Indian Mountain.

Major construction projects and roadway improvements benefit from our professional-grade road base material. Contractors throughout Hot Springs rely on this aggregate for its consistent quality and excellent load-bearing capacity when establishing foundations for heavy traffic areas.

Drainage Solutions for Hot Springs Properties

Managing water effectively presents one of the greatest challenges for Hot Springs property owners. The combination of abundant rainfall, steep terrain, and clay soils means proper drainage installation is not optional but essential. Our drain rock provides the permeability needed to channel water away from foundations and prevent erosion on hillside properties throughout the area.

French drain systems have become increasingly popular in neighborhoods like Treasure Hills and Cedar Glades where natural water flow must be redirected to protect homes and landscapes. Our drainage aggregates allow water to flow freely while filtering out debris that could clog underground pipes.

Why Drainage Matters in Hot Springs

The Ouachita Mountain terrain creates natural water channeling that intensifies during the frequent spring thunderstorms Hot Springs experiences. Properties near the base of slopes or in lower-lying areas of West Hot Springs especially benefit from strategic drainage aggregate installation. Properly installed drain rock systems protect foundations, prevent basement flooding, and preserve landscape integrity during heavy rain events.

Frequently Asked Questions About Aggregates in Hot Springs

What type of gravel works best for Hot Springs driveways?

For Hot Springs driveways, we recommend starting with a crusher run base layer for stability, topped with 3/4 inch crushed stone for the surface. This combination handles the hilly terrain and heavy rainfall common in our area while providing excellent durability and drainage. Steeper driveways in areas like Indian Mountain may benefit from angular crushed stone that locks together and resists migration.

How do I prevent gravel from washing away on sloped properties?

Sloped Hot Springs properties require proper grading, adequate base preparation, and strategic drainage installation. Using angular crushed stone rather than rounded river rock helps materials interlock and resist movement. Installing French drains upslope from driveways redirects water before it can cause erosion. Many hillside properties also benefit from retaining wall construction using larger aggregates.

How much aggregate do I need for a typical Hot Springs driveway?

A typical Hot Springs driveway measuring 12 feet wide by 50 feet long requires approximately 8-10 tons of aggregate for proper base and surface layers combined. However, steeper driveways and those with poor existing base conditions may require additional material. Contact our team with your specific measurements for accurate quantity estimates tailored to your property.

What sand is best for paver installation in Hot Springs?

Mason sand provides the ideal bedding layer for paver installation throughout Hot Springs. This fine, consistent sand creates a level base that allows for precise paver placement while facilitating drainage. For joint filling between pavers, polymeric sand may be recommended depending on your specific application and traffic expectations.

What is the best time of year to install a gravel driveway in Hot Springs?

Fall and spring offer ideal conditions for gravel driveway installation in Hot Springs. Moderate temperatures allow for proper compaction, and the ground remains workable without excessive moisture or summer heat complications. However, our team can accommodate projects year-round, adjusting techniques as needed for seasonal conditions.
